Sloped yard landscaping in Franklin, TN presents unique challenges and opportunities. Common problems include soil erosion, drainage issues, and difficulty in maintaining an even, aesthetically pleasing appearance. Homeowners in this region often need solutions that address these challenges while enhancing the natural beauty of their sloped yards. Effective solutions might involve terracing, retaining walls, and strategic plant selection to prevent erosion and improve drainage. These methods not only stabilize the landscape but also create visually appealing outdoor spaces that blend seamlessly with the local environment.

- Retaining Wall Installation: Ideal for managing erosion and runoff in sloped landscapes, retaining walls add both functionality and aesthetic appeal by creating terraced levels that can be used for planting or other landscape features.
- Drainage Solutions: Proper drainage systems are crucial for sloped yards to prevent water accumulation and soil erosion. Techniques include French drains and surface drains that effectively manage water flow and protect landscaping.
- Native Plant Landscaping: Utilizing native plants that are adapted to the local climate and soil conditions can enhance the sustainability of a sloped yard, reducing maintenance and water usage while supporting local biodiversity.
- Pathway Construction: Building pathways on a slope can enhance accessibility and reduce wear on the landscape. Materials like flagstone or pavers provide stability and add visual interest to the yard.
- Outdoor Staircases: Installing staircases on a slope improves navigation across different levels of the yard and can be designed to complement the overall landscape aesthetics.
- Rock Gardens: Rock gardens are an excellent choice for sloped yards as they provide an attractive solution to soil erosion while requiring minimal maintenance.
- Water Features: Incorporating water features such as cascading waterfalls or streams can take advantage of natural slope gradients, creating a dynamic element in the landscape that also helps with soil stabilization.
- Terraced Gardening: Terracing turns a sloped yard into a series of level growing spaces, which can be used for flowers, vegetables, or herbs, increasing the usable garden area and reducing erosion.
- Xeriscaping: This landscaping method minimizes the need for irrigation by using drought-resistant plants and mulching, making it suitable for sloped areas where water distribution might be challenging.
